Transaction 602c3f88ac2066a95bdd5b84a16c73d6cd1dabc796415bca39e47200e23e72c5
1 Input
1 Output
-
602c3f88ac2066a95bdd5b84a16c73d6cd1dabc796415bca39e47200e23e72c5:0
- value
- 596659
- script pubkey
- OP_0 OP_PUSHBYTES_20 edeefff737a4bd73c95110a08888707e541017f3
- address
- bc1qahh0laeh5j7h8j23zzsg3zrs0e2pq9lnftle2p